Since angle LOM and angle MON are complementary, we can use the equation:
m∠LOM + m∠MON = 90°
Substituting the given values:
(x + 15)° + 48° = 90°
Therefore, the equation that could be used to solve for x is:
(x + 15) + 48 = 90
